Hi ,
Just wondering what the best way going about adding extra iso's to the bootable USB I made without overwriting anything. (forgot to add ubuntu :) )

I have manually added extra things of my own, like a couple of iso and dont want them to go.

For add only Ubuntu at the USB....check only Ubuntu checkbox and make USB. SARDU see old "version" made, add Ubuntu and remake the menu adding Ubuntu.
